The Best of South African Couture and Jewellery for Miss World 2008 Contestants
................................................................................................................................
Miss World 2008 is being held in South Africa this year. The event will take place on the 13th December 2008 at the Sandton Convention Centre in Johannesburg................................................................................................
You can look forward to an exciting spin on the pageant that has lost its luster over the years, 30 South African fashion designers and 20 crafters producing over 580 garments and accessories will dress the 112 Miss World contestants. Participating designers include African Mosaique, Clive Rundle, Palesa Mokubung, David Tlale, Marianne Fassler, Fred Eboka, Gavin Rajah, Machere Pooe, Julian, Thula Sindi, amongst others. Designers will be exploring colour, texture and silhouettes in a way that will amaze and inspire, hopefully discarding the sequin Southern Belle gowns that have come to dominate over the years.
....................................................................................................................................
According to local fashion impresario Precious Moloi-Motsepe who is coordinating the fashion for 112 of the world's most beautiful women, this will present the local designers with "an unparalleled coup for the local industry". According to iFashion.co.za,
In order to ensure that both designers and crafters receive the maximum benefit from this relationship, the design and craft label will be identified on screen during the finale broadcast. Interested viewers will be directed towards an online e-commerce site – www.africanfashioninternational.com – to download details of the designers, and to order garments directly. This will result in direct commercial benefit to participating designers and crafters.
